What You’ll Do
- Manages the preconstruction development cycle from conceptual design to permit for construction plans, providing input relating to cost analysis, constructability, potential schedule impacts, and value-engineering opportunities.
- Review of project plans, requirements, and specifications to develop a comprehensive understanding of the project.
- Oversees the quantitative take-off process to ensure accuracy and completeness of each plan development cycle.
- Manages the development of each scope of work to deliver comprehensiveness and thoroughness thereby eliminating scope gap and scope overlap.
- Oversees the subcontractor and vendor solicitation of bids to ensure complete scope and pricing-balanced coverage of the project scopes.
- Leads and manages communication and presentations with Owner and Design Team.
- Develops and maintains good working relationships with Owner, development partners, architects, consultants, engineers, subcontractors, vendors, manufactures, and other project specialists and team members to achieve project goals.
- Organizes project-related tasks with key contributors to ensure adherence to project goal.
- Properly tracks and accounts for changes in pricing and scope during plan development process.
- Consistently meets pricing deadlines.
- Manages team production rates based on workload.
- Delivers complete turnover package to Project Manager.
- Ensure team maintains project finish tracker.
- Mentor and develop team members.
- Oversee and manage estimating software.
- Builds and manages the invite to bid (ITB) platform and process, including but not limited to invites, bidding documents, pricing documents, scope documents, etc.
